miniqmt是什么意思?相较qmt有哪些区别或优势?
发布时间:2024-9-24 15:29阅读:170
mini QMT 是 QMT(Quantitative Market Trading)的一个简化版本,主要面向那些需要更高编程灵活性和更强自定义能力的量化交易者。它通过Python包的形式提供API,使得用户可以在Python环境中直接调用相关功能,这为开发和维护量化策略提供了极大的便利。
mini QMT相较QMT的区别和优势
1. 编程灵活性:
mini QMT:通过Python包提供API,允许用户在Python环境中调用相关功能,这意味着用户可以将其与其他Python程序无缝集成,开发更复杂和更具创新性的量化策略。
QMT:通常是一个独立的交易软件,提供图形界面和一些脚本编写功能,但在编程灵活性和可扩展性上不如mini QMT。
2. 策略结构:
mini QMT:只提供数据源和交易接口,这样策略可以与QMT软件解耦,更利于维护和更新策略代码。
QMT:策略和交易软件可能是紧密耦合的,更新和维护成本较高。
3. 平台限制:
mini QMT:由于以Python包的形式存在,可以在任何支持Python的环境中运行,不受特定交易平台或客户端的限制。
QMT:通常是一个特定的交易平台,用户需要在该平台的环境中运行策略。
4. 开发环境:
mini QMT:利用Python的丰富生态系统,可以结合使用各种Python库(如numpy、pandas、matplotlib等)进行数据处理和分析。
QMT:开发环境可能相对封闭,用户可用的工具和库有限。
5. 用户群体:
mini QMT:适合具有一定编程能力和金融知识的量化交易者,尤其是那些希望在Python环境中进行策略开发和测试的用户。
QMT:适合那些希望使用图形化界面进行交易和策略开发的用户,可能对编程能力要求较低。
如何获取mini QMT?
1. 联系券商:首先需要联系你的券商,询问是否支持mini QMT功能。并不是所有券商都提供这项服务。或者联系方经理,开通miniqmt权限。
2. 开通QMT权限:券商支持mini QMT功能后,按照流程开通QMT权限。
3. 获取Python包:一旦开通QMT权限,通常会有相关的Python包或API文档提供。按照券商提供的指南进行安装和配置。
注意事项
券商支持:并不是所有券商都支持mini QMT功能,因此在开通之前一定要确认清楚。
技术准备:确保你具备一定的编程能力和Python知识,这样才能充分利用mini QMT的优势。
测试环境:建议在正式交易前,先使用模拟账户或小资金进行测试,确保策略的稳定性和可靠性。
总之,mini QMT为那些希望通过编程实现更高自由度和灵活性的量化交易者提供了一个非常有力的工具。
我司支持ptrade和qmt两套量化系统,有技术服务支撑和基础学习课程,提供服务交流群。
温馨提示:投资有风险,选择需谨慎。